Pizhichil

Yesterday i had my 3rd kind of treatment – pixhicil

this is where two ladies pour hot medicated oil up and down your body while the third keeps heating the oil. Ofter they pour a pitcher up and down they then sweep the oil down with their hands so it is a massage as well.

how good can it get – well pizhichil i think is that good

it is difficult to describe inwords the experience because of all the herbal smells and the sounds of the women talking in malalayam – a sing song up and down curly kind of language that uses more octaves than we even know about.

after the massage you get a shower with hot water thrown over you after you scrub down with chick pea flour – it is somewhat abrasive and amazingly you are not oily after

then you go and rest and listen to the cows and the women banging the clothes on the rocks and the birds crickets and the political loud speakers for the upcoming election and the dynamite at the distant quary
